SEO ranking software Secrets
join for the TechRadar Pro publication to obtain all the top rated information, feeling, characteristics and guidance your online business really should realize success!
Moz Pro is definitely an all-in-1 Web optimization Instrument ideal for any severe Search engine optimization Specialist aiming t